toilet paper rolls
(Preview)
I have 1 5/8" header pipes to cut at 1" intervals with a 15 degree angle on one end. I discovered that toilet paper cardboard rolls slide nicely over the pipe so I cut one end of the roll at 15 degrees. Then for every piece, I slide the roll over the pipe and mark it. Whether the straight cut side or the angl...
